  • Publication number: 20020021733
    Abstract: A multi-wavelength surface emitting laser for emitting light having different wavelengths includes a lower reflector, an active layer and an upper reflector which are integrally formed above one substrate. The multi-wavelength surface emitting laser is manufactured by forming a first surface emitting laser, partially removing a first upper reflector, a first active layer, and a first lower reflection layer by etching. A protection film is formed on the outer surface of the first surface emitting laser. A second surface emitting laser is formed by removing a second lower reflector, a second active layer, and a second upper reflection layer formed on the protection film by etching. The protection film is removed and first and second upper electrodes are formed on upper surfaces of the first and second upper reflection layers, respectively, and a lower electrode is formed on a bottom surface of the substrate.

  • Patent number: 6327339
    Abstract: An industrial X-ray/electron beam source includes an accelerator having a) a coaxial cavity b) an electron gun for emitting an electron beam to be accelerated, c) at least one deflection magnet positioned outside of the cavity, and d) a radio frequency power supply means for supplying power of a radio frequency to the cavity to induce TM010 mode as an accelerating mode in the cavity; and a beam irradiator having a two-dimensional scanning magnet which deflects accelerated beam by the accelerator, an extracting window for extracting the deflected electron beam to be irradiated to an object, and means for guiding the deflected beam toward a center of the extracting window in a radial direction. The source is advantageous in that the electron beams do not intersect inside the cavity, which can reduce beam loss, and that beams or X-rays are irradiated to the object spatially uniformly.

  • Patent number: 6215091
    Abstract: The plasma torch has a cathode supporter having a front end and a rear end, mounted on the body at the rear end thereof; a button-cathode for generating plasma arc, which is assembled to the front end of the cathode supporter; a hollow-cathode having an inner surface and an outer surface, surrounding the button-cathode, the inner surface of which is spaced from the button-cathode, being assembled to the cathode supporter, and being made of material with higher work function than material for the button-cathode. The plasma gas flows along the outer surface to accomplish low gas pressure between the inner surface of the hollow-cathode and the button-cathode. A multiple-solenoid coil is adapted to rotate arc root around the button-cathode and to move arc root axially along the surface of the button-cathode.
